Goldsmith v. Gorokhovsky
Opinion of the Court
In an action to recover damages due to personal injuries, the defendant appeals from an order of the Supreme Court, Queens County (Leviss, J.), entered September 13, 1992, which granted the plaintiff’s motion to restore the action to the trial calendar.
Ordered that the order is affirmed, with costs.
